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els

FrontbrakesDual disc
Frontbrakesdiameter298 mm (11.7 inches)
Fronttyre120/70-ZR17
Frontwheeltravel120 mm (4.7 inches)
RearbrakesSingle disc
Rearbrakesdiameter220 mm (8.7 inches)
Reartyre180/55-ZR17
Rearwheeltravel130 mm (5.1 inches)

Engine & Transmission

Borexstroke98.0 x 66.0 mm (3.9 x 2.6 inches)
Displacement996.00 ccm (60.78 cubic inches)
EnginedetailsV2, four-stroke
FuelsystemInjection
Gearbox6-speed
Power106.00 HP (77.4 kW)) @ 8500 RPM
Topspeed225.0 km/h (139.8 mph)
Torque90.00 Nm (9.2 kgf-m or 66.4 ft.lbs) @ 7000 RPM
TransmissiontypefinaldriveChain
Valvespercylinder4

Physical Measures & Capacities

Dryweight192.0 kg (423.3 pounds)
Fuelcapacity18.00 litres (4.76 gallons)
Powerweightratio0.5521 HP/kg
Seatheight775 mm (30.5 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ting.

About Cagiva Raptor 1000 2001

Introducing the 2001 Cagiva Raptor 1000, a motorcycle that embodies the spirit of naked bike performance with a flair for Italian style. Launched during a golden era of motorcycling, the Raptor 1000 carved out its niche within the market as a powerful and agile machine, perfect for both spirited rides on twisty roads and urban commutes. With its minimalist design, this bike showcases the essence of what a naked bike should be—stripped down, raw, and ready to deliver an exhilarating riding experience.

At the heart of the Raptor 1000 lies a robust V2, four-stroke engine with a displacement of 996cc, generating an impressive 106 horsepower at 8,500 RPM. This powerplant does more than just roar; it delivers a hearty torque of 90 Nm at 7,000 RPM, ensuring that riders feel the rush from the moment they twist the throttle. With a top speed of 225 km/h (139.8 mph), the Raptor is built for those who seek thrill. The six-speed gearbox and chain final drive facilitate smooth gear changes, allowing riders to tap into the full potential of this machine while enjoying the road ahead.

The Raptor 1000 is not just about raw power; it’s packed with features designed for comfort and control. The dual disc front brakes, with a diameter of 298 mm, provide impressive stopping power, while the rear single disc brake ensures stability during deceleration. The suspension system, featuring 120 mm of front travel and 130 mm at the rear, strikes a balance between agility and comfort, making it adept at handling various road conditions. With a lightweight frame weighing in at just 192 kg (423.3 pounds) and a seat height of 775 mm (30.5 inches), this bike feels nimble and accessible to a wide range of riders.

PROs:

  1. Powerful Performance: The V2 engine provides exhilarating acceleration and a spirited top speed, perfect for thrill-seekers.
  2. Agile Handling: With a lightweight design and responsive suspension, the Raptor 1000 excels in cornering and maneuverability.
  3. Striking Aesthetics: Its minimalist, aggressive styling makes it a head-turner, showcasing Italian design flair.

CONs:

  1. Limited Wind Protection: As a naked bike, it offers minimal wind protection, which may not appeal to long-distance riders.
  2. Fuel Capacity: The 18-litre fuel tank may require more frequent stops on longer journeys compared to touring bikes.
  3. Comfort for Longer Rides: While the Raptor 1000 is agile, the seating position may not be the most comfortable for prolonged use.
